1. Lay sand traps (lot of crater with no way of getting back up for the ants, similar to what dragonfly larvae make) and put them all over near and around the Harvester ant or other species nests that is being attacked by Argentine ants or Imported fire ants.
2. Make sand barriers (like walls) all around the Harvester ant nest. These walls are sandy and hard for the Argentine ant to climb up it.
3. Make small canyons all around the harvester ants in front of the sandy walls, these are good because they are somewhat like sand traps but on a bigger scale and help the sandy walls a lot.
Salt might work to, sea salt works to keep Argentine ants away but that might have a bad affect on the Harvester ants.

So what it would be like is this. Sand traps in front of everything, sand barriers behind the sand traps, and the canyon type in front of the barriers.
